The announcement was made during a meeting held along with Mudiraj Corporation Chairman Borra Gyaneshwar.
The meeting was attended by Panduga Sayanna’s biographer Indiramma, former ZPTC member Bekkam Janardhan, Telangana Mudiraj Mahasabha district president Mettukadi Prabhakar, Panduga Sayanna Social Service Society president Krishna Mudiraj, and Sayanna’s descendants Narsimlu, Chennayya, and Srinivas, among others.
Addressing the gathering, Vakiti said the government is committed to preserving Panduga Sayanna’s legacy and introducing his sacrifices to future generations.
He stated that the committee would examine historical and scientific evidence to resolve the long-standing ambiguity over the dates of Sayanna’s birth and death anniversaries.
The decision was welcomed by admirers of Panduga Sayanna, members of the Bahujan community, and those who have worked to preserve his history.
